Mácha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Mácha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Mácha occurs most in Czechia. It may also be rendered as: Macha, Machä or Machá. For other potential spellings of this last name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Mácha? popularity and diffusion
It is the 374,335th most frequently occurring family name throughout the world. It is borne by around 1 in 7,614,991 people. The last name Mácha is predominantly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Mácha live; 99 percent live in Eastern Europe and 99 percent live in West Slavic Europe.
This last name is most frequently used in Czechia, where it is carried by 942 people, or 1 in 11,288. In Czechia Mácha is most frequent in: Moravian-Silesian Region, where 22 percent are found, South Bohemian Region, where 22 percent are found and Central Bohemian Region, where 19 percent are found. Beside Czechia this surname exists in 2 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 1 percent are found and Slovakia, where 1 percent are found.
